This print titled "Baltimore Oriole, 1827" by Robert Havell takes us back to the enchanting world of 19th-century America. The image showcases the exquisite artistry and attention to detail that Havell was renowned for. In this hand-colored engraving and aquatint on Whatman wove paper, Havell captures the vibrant beauty of a Baltimore Oriole perched delicately on a branch. The bird's striking orange plumage contrasts against the lush green backdrop, creating a visually stunning composition. Havell's meticulous technique brings out every intricate feather pattern and texture with remarkable precision. Through his skillful use of color and shading, he breathes life into this songbird, making it seem as if it could burst into song at any moment. The Baltimore Oriole is not only an artistic masterpiece but also serves as an important contribution to ornithology. Its inclusion in John James Audubon's monumental work on American birds solidifies its significance in both scientific study and artistic representation. Displayed proudly at the National Gallery of Art in Washington, D. C. , this print stands as a testament to Havell's talent and dedication to capturing nature's wonders through his artwork.
